Repo for article "NeuralSympCheck: A Symptom Checking and Disease Diagnostic Neural Model with Logic Regularization"

Overview

This archive contains code to reproduce the main results described in the article "NeuralSympCheck: A Symptom Checking and Disease Diagnostic Neural Model with Logic Regularization".

To reproduce these results, follow the steps described below.

1. Clone this repository

2. Environment

Create an isolated environment with venv or conda. Install the dependencies listed in the src/requirements.txt

3. Download datasets

Download datasets from https://drive.google.com/drive/folders/19Jv_4wwC6LM485hDf8O5uhYb8QbAZOms?usp=sharing and put its to the folder data/05_model_input

4. Run pipelines

Activate the environment and run this command at the root of the repository: kedro run --pipeline symptom_checker --params device:device,ds_name:ds_name,mode:test

Where:

  • device - GPU idx or 'cpu'
  • ds_name:
    • mz - for MuZhi dataset
    • dxy - for Dxy dataset
    • symcat_200 - for SymCat dataset with 200 deseases
    • symcat_300 - for SymCat dataset with 300 deseases
    • symcat_400 - for SymCat dataset with 400 deseases

The following results will be saved after the Pipeline is completed:

  • model in the folder data/06_models
  • metrics in the folder data/08_reporting
